Regulation is a critical factor for Bulgaria traders. FP Markets is regulated by top-tier authorities: ASIC (Australia) and CySEC (Cyprus), offering strong client protection including negative balance protection and investor compensation schemes. FBS is regulated by the IFSC (Belize), which provides less stringent oversight. The Bulgarian local financial regulator (Financial Supervision Commission) does not directly oversee either broker, but FP Markets’ CySEC regulation ensures compliance with EU standards, which may offer additional comfort to Bulgaria traders. FBS’s regulatory framework is more relaxed, which could be a concern for risk-averse traders.
